X^3-8/x-2 simplify and I need an explanation please

Answer: x^2+2x+4

Step-by-step explanation:

The expression given in the exercise is:

 \frac{x^3-8}{x-2}

If you descompose the number 8 into its prime factors, you get that:

8=2*2*2=2^3

Therefore, you can rewrite the numerator of the expression as following:

=\frac{(x^3-2^3)}{(x-2)}

For this exercise you need to remember that for a  Difference of cubes:

a^3-b^3=(a-b)(a^2+ab+b^2)

Then, applying this, you get:

=\frac{(x-2)(x^2+2x+2^2)}{(x-2)}=\frac{(x-2)(x^2+2x+4)}{(x-2)}

Now, it is necessary to remember the following:

\frac{a}{a}=1

Knowing the above, you can say that:

\frac{(x-2)}{(x-2)}=1

Therefore applying this, you get that the simplified expression is:

=x^2+2x+4

Olga invests $3000 in an account that earns 1.3% annual interest compounded monthly. How many years will it take for the balance
anygoal [31]

It will take 39.3 years for the balance of this account to reach $5000

Step-by-step explanation:

Formula for time (t)

t = \frac{ln(\frac{A}{P})}{n[ln(1+\frac{r}{n})]}

Where:

1. A = the value of the accrued investment/loan

2. P = the principal amount

3. r = the annual interest rate (decimal)

4. n = the number of times that interest is compounded per unit t

5. t = the time the money is invested or borrowed  

∵ Olga invests $3000 in an account that earns 1.3% annual interest

   compounded monthly

∴ P = $3000

∴ r = 1.3% = 1.3 ÷ 100 = 0.013 ⇒ annual interest

∴ n = 12 ⇒ compounded monthly

∵ The account will reach $5000

∴ A = 5000

- Substitute these values in the rule above

∴ t = \frac{ln(\frac{5000}{3000})}{12[ln(1+\frac{0.013}{12})]}

∴ t = 39.3 years

It will take 39.3 years for the balance of this account to reach $5000
